Ten strangers are lured to a solitary mansion on an island off the coast of Devon. They sit down for dinner and a record begins to play. The voice of their host accuses each person of hiding a guilty secret. When a terrible storm cuts them off from the mainland, and with their hosts mysteriously absent, the true reason for their presence on the island becomes horribly clear, as secrets from their past come back to haunt each one of them. A Forgotten Exodus – London Film Premiere This is a unique opportunity to see A Forgotten Exodus,a two-part documentary made by the Dutch film-maker Marcel Prins. The film has been broadcast on the Dutch television channel NPO. With the establishment of the state of Israel in 1948, the situation of almost a million Jews, whose communities had been settled in the region for millennia, deteriorated. Eight former refugees, born in Baghdad, Aleppo, Tripoli, Fez, Cairo, Aden and Sana’a tell how they were forced to flee as children or teenagers to Israel. They talk about how the atmosphere changed and how they were forced to travel (most illegally) by truck, boat or plane out of their countries of birth. Their stories are brought to life with animation and film clips rarely seen before. For several interviewees, the horrors of 7 October 2023 brought back memories of anti-Jewish violence and terror in Arab countries. The experiences they describe are more relevant than ever. Raven Chacon is a composer, performer, and installation artist born at Fort Defiance, Navajo Nation. A recording artist over the span of 22 years, Chacon has appeared on over 80 releases on national and international labels. He has exhibited, performed, or had works performed at LACMA, The Whitney Biennial, Borealis Festival, SITE Santa Fe, The Kennedy Center, and more. As an educator, Chacon is the senior composer mentor for the Native American Composer Apprentice Project (NACAP) As an educator, Chacon is the senior composer mentor for the Native American Composer Apprentice Project (NACAP). In 2022, he was awarded the Pulitzer Prize in Music for his composition Voiceless Mass. In 2023, he also was awarded the MacArthur Fellowship. The word PENCHMI (in Wolof is written as “Penccmi”) is used to describe the gathering of ancestors, transcending time and space, as well as the gathering of the elders of the traditional Senegalese villages, in the center of the community under a baobab tree. Penchmi is the space to discuss matters of LIFE, FREEDOM, and PEACE. Most importantly, it serves to remind us of the LOVE and RESPECT shared among each other. This autumn. we invite you all to three PENCHMI drum + dance portals in Folklore Hoxton in 186 Hackney Road, London. Come prepared to drum, dance, and joyfully sweat, allowing your spirit to soar high by connecting through ancestral rhythms, songs, and African wisdom channelled by Dembis Thioung. Dembis takes pride in being guided by the highest Senegalese value of TERANGA : welcoming, sharing and supporting each other in happiness always, valuing wealth not for its quantity but for the generosity extended to others. TERANGA represents the essence of Senegalese culture and it can be translated with the word hospitality. Parmigianino: The Vision of Saint Jerome | The National Gallery
Dec 5, 2024–Mar 9, 2025 (UTC)ENDED
London
Witness one of the most visionary artists of the Renaissance at work and
rediscover his masterpiece that pushed art in a new direction. This
exhibition explores the creation of Parmigianino’s 'The Madonna and
Child with Saints', also known as ‘The Vision of Saint Jerome’. It
returns to public display for the first time in 10 years following
conservation. Born in the Northern Italian city of Parma, after which he
was nicknamed, Girolamo Francesco Maria Mazzola (1503‒1540) was a child
prodigy. He drew constantly. At age 21 he moved to Rome, where he
impressed the Pope and was praised as a ‘Raphael reborn’. This
altarpiece was his first major work there. In 1527, the Sack of Rome
erupted around him while he finished the painting. According to legend,
looting Imperial soldiers invading his studio were so amazed by it that
they let him continue. Parmigianino made many drawings to work out his
final composition. They range from velvety chalk studies to swirling pen
and ink sketches. We reunite a variety of them with the painting for
the first time. Part of our Bicentenary celebrations, this is a rare
opportunity to encounter Parmigianino’s dynamic creative process.

Frank Bowling, now 90 years old and still painting every day in his south London studio, has been hailed as a ‘modern master’ and one of the most innovative painters of our time. This conversation between artists, art historians and Bowling’s son, will explore Frank Bowling’s 65-year career including the extraordinary colours and forms that emerge in the paintings. It will explore his techniques of pouring, throwing, dripping, spilling and spraying acrylic paint and gel on canvas and paper on the floor and walls of his studio, using materials including fluorescent, pearlescent and metallic pigments and found objects. The discussion will investigate the artist’s practice surrounded by a display of prints of Bowling’s works from across his career.
